Observe and be free
Enjoy all things that come to you in life. But remember always to bring  your sword of discrimination with you. In the midst of success, while everyone at the party is celebrating you, is having a wonderful time, don't celebrate. Observe. Enjoy the party, don't hate it. Don't feel badly about those who are in illusion. Don't feel that you are superior, because I assure you, you are not. But observe quietly and remain empty, empty in the sense that you are filled with light and knowledge and empty and void of attachment.

In the midst of failure, do not be upset. When people say terrible things about you, when your body ages and doesn't work the way it used to, do not be upset. In illness, in fatigue, when your spirits are down, remember: observe. Do not attach yourself to these conditions. Simply observe the turn the movie is taking as it's being projected on the screen, but know that these events and these experiences that you call life are but phantoms, and will one day pass away and you will remain because you are That. You are immortal consciousness. You are free and perfect. And even though at this time you are not fully aware of that, if you remember these words at the time of your death, at the time of your birth, in the midst of any experience of success, failure, pleasure, pain, depression, elation -- if you remember this, you will be free.

- "The Truth", Talks on the Nature of Existence, Insights
